I don't understand why people seem intent on diminishing what Brentford have been doing. Here's a post from a few weeks ago that highlights not only where they have been so successful (certainly in monetary terms, if not yet league status) but also more starkly only underlines how pitiful our dealings have been by comparison.

  

On 20/07/2020 at 19:13, sheriwozgod said:

With all of us desperate to know our fate re the financial state of the club after 5 years of DC,s reign,  i thought i would share this list that someone sent me detailing some of Brentfords dealings during the same period.

 

Andre Gray - cost £300,000   -   sold for £9 Million

Jota  -  cost £1.2 Million   -   sold for £7.5 Million

Maxime Colin   -   cost £1 Million   -   sold for £2.5 Million

Harlee Dean   -   cost nothing   -   sold for £2 Million

Ryan Woods   -   cost £1 Million   -   sold for £7 Million

John Egan   -   cost nothing   -   sold for £3.5 Million

Lasse Vibe   -   cost £1 Million   -   sold for £2 Million

Daniel Bentley   -   cost £1 Million   -   sold for £2 Million

Romaine Sawyers   -   cost nothing   -   sold for £3 Million

Jozefoon  -   cost £1 Million   -   sold for £2.75 Million

Chris Mepham   -   cost nothing   -   sold for £12 Million

Moses Odubajo   -   cost £1 Million   -   sold for £3.5 Million

Will Grigg   -   cost £400,000   -   sold for £1 Million

Stuart Dallas   -   cost nothing   -   sold for £1.3 Million

James Tarkowski   -   cost £250,000   -   sold for £3 Million

Scott Hogan   -   cost £750,000   -   sold for £9 Million

Neal Maupay    -   cost £1.5 Million   -   sold for £20 Million

 

Makes you fu**in weep doesnt it.

 

You can now add to that impressive list...

 

Ollie Watkins  -  cost £1.8 million  -  sold for £28 million (potentially rising to £33 million)
